Romanian Purchases Via EU-Funded Projects To Be Checked Regardless Of Value – Draft

Purchases made through projects financed from European Union non-reimbursable funds will be checked by the Department Coordinating and Verifying Public Purchases, regardless of their estimated value and the way they were assigned, says a draft emergency decree drawn up by the Finance Ministry.

Bucharest Public Transport Authority To Buy 150 Trolleybuses For EUR60M

RATB, the public transport authority in Romania’s capital Bucharest, will begin on January 11, 2010 the process to purchase 150 trolleybuses, in a contract worth an estimated EUR60 million, net of VAT.

Romania ’08 Budget Spending EUR500M Vs. EUR50M In ’07

Romanian public institutions and state-owned companies bought cars, laptops and furniture worth over EUR500 million in 2008, tenfold higher compared with total purchases of EUR50 million in 2007, and most contracts were signed with private suppliers during August-December 2008.

Romanian Police Car Purchases Are Clean – Police Official

The head of the Romanian Police (IGPR), Gheorghe Popa, said that, at his request, DGA, DGIPI, DIF, and SRI informed that there are no suspicions regarding the contracts for the purchase of police cars.
